Développeur ASP.Net Core Full Stack (H/F)

  • 143 Rue d'Athènes, 59800 Lille, France
  • Temps complet
  • Département: Digital

Description de l'entreprise

Notre activité s’articule autour des hommes et des femmes qui nous rejoignent. C’est grâce à eux que nous déployons notre savoir-faire dans les domaines de l’industrie, de la construction et des systèmes d'information.  

À la confluence du conseil en ingénierie et du conseil numérique, le dépassement de soi est ce qui nous lie. Depuis Lille et Paris, les équipes NJ PARTNERS sont guidées par l'écoute et la disponibilité. Cette combinaison unique de proximité est garante de la compréhension des marchés sur lesquels nous intervenons.  

Afin que ces passions nourrissent la croissance, elles se doivent de l’être sans contrainte : NJ PARTNERS bénéficie d’une indépendance financière totale et son développement est réalisé sur la base de fonds propres. 

Nous rejoindre, c’est trouver sa place au sein d’une équipe jeune et dynamique en recherche de performance et de succès communs. Notre principal moteur est l’épanouissement de chacun car nous sommes convaincus qu’il est la seule solution à l’épanouissement de tous.  

Ceux qui ont choisi de nous accompagner, qu’ils soient collaborateurs, stagiaires, clients, consultants, partenaires ou tout simplement contributeurs d’idées, le confirmeront : l’histoire de NJ PARTNERS, nous la construisons ensemble. 

Vous partagez ces valeurs, contactez-nous ! 

Description du poste

Dans le cadre de vos fonctions, vous réaliserez des missions de conseil et expertise pour accompagner nos clients dans l’évolution et l’industrialisation de leur système d'information déployé dans le Cloud. 

Le mouvement Software Craftsmanship est votre guide ?  

Vous pensez que la collaboration les Devs, les Utilisateurs et les Ops est indispensable ?  

En tant que membre d'une équipe agile qui conçoit, développe et déploie l'usine logicielle de demain, votre rôle sera de :  

  • Analyser les documents fonctionnels entrants (cahier des charges, spécifications générales ou détaillées, user stories...) afin d'identifier la solution technique à mettre en œuvre 

  • Estimer la complexité et proposer les architectures techniques adaptées au contexte de l'entreprise  

  • Participer activement aux réunions de l'équipe dans un environnement agile (daily, rétro, sprint planning) et effectuer un reporting d’avancement des tâches confiées 

  • Développer et maintenir les applications et nouvelles fonctionnalités selon les spécifications et la solution d’implémentation définie avec le lead developper et le chef de projet technique 

  • Concevoir des outils de tests automatisés efficaces et réutilisables 

  • Réaliser les tests unitaires, les tests d’intégration et participer aux revues de codes de l’équipe 

  • Ecrire et dérouler des scénarii des tests de charges et de performance 

  • Piloter le déploiement en recette et mises en production des développements, en collaboration avec les équipes d’intégration DevOps et d’exploitation 

  • Support aux équipes de production pour la résolution d’incidents 

  • Rédaction de la documentation technique 

Qualifications

Issu(e) d'une formation de niveau BAC+4/BAC+5 en informatique, vous êtes fort(e) d'au moins 2 à 3 ans d'expérience professionnelle.  

Vous êtes un développeur qui a pratiqué de manière épisodique le métier de l'exploitation. Vous maîtrisez les pratiques Agiles en tant que membre d'équipe et connaissez les différentes phases du cycle de vie d'un produit de la conception au déploiement.  

Alors cette offre est faite pour vous ! N’hésitez plus, contactez-nous et nous vous expliquerons tout au long de votre processus de recrutement pourquoi NJ Partners est une ESN qui se veut différente !  

Compétences techniques  

  • Front-End : Javascript, Typescript, Angular, React.js, Vue.js, jQuery, Bootstrap …  

  • Back-End : ASP.Net Core 

  • Web service REST : Swagger, Postman … 

  • ORM : Entity Framework 

  • Test : Xunit, Selenium, Cucumber, Mockito … 

  • Qualité de code : SonarQube, Codacy … 

  • Outils CI/CD : Jenkins, Azure DevOps 

  • Outils d’Infrastructure As Code : Terraform, Ansible, XL Deploy …  

  • Environnements Cloud : Azure, AWS, GCP, OVH … 

  • Bases de données : MySQL, Oracle, SQL Server, NoSQL 

  • Système d’exploitation : Windows Server, Linux 

  • Méthodologie : Scrum, Kanban, Craftmanship, TDD/BDD